The Chambrès Lagos Debuts, Targets Growing Demand for Experience-Driven Hospitality

June 14, 2026

A new hospitality and entertainment destination, The Chambrès Lagos, has opened in Victoria Island, betting on a growing shift in consumer preferences toward curated social experiences, flexible premium offerings and meaningful networking opportunities.

Located within the Oriental Hotel, the venue enters Lagos’ competitive hospitality market with a concept that industry observers say reflects broader changes in how urban professionals and social consumers engage with nightlife and leisure experiences.

At the heart of the concept is the introduction of champagne and ultra-premium single malt whisky served by the glass, a model designed to make high-end beverage experiences more accessible without the traditional requirement of purchasing full bottles.

The launch comes amid increasing demand for hospitality offerings that prioritize experience, social connection and lifestyle value over conventional nightclub formats. Across major cities globally, consumers are spending more on carefully curated experiences, and operators in Lagos are beginning to adapt to the trend.

The Chambrès Lagos combines hospitality, entertainment, music and lifestyle programming within an environment designed to encourage conversation, networking and relaxed social interaction.

As part of its offering, the venue has introduced three recurring weekly experiences aimed at different audience segments. These include OG-B4-IG (Old School Before Instagram), a nostalgia-themed social gathering centered on classic music and interpersonal connection; Luxe Friday, a networking-focused event for professionals, entrepreneurs and corporate executives; and Vibe Check, a female-led karaoke and lounge experience inspired by Lagos’ contemporary music and creative culture.

Speaking on the concept behind the launch, management partner AXIOM Limited said consumer expectations within the hospitality sector continue to evolve, particularly among individuals seeking quality service, good music and authentic social engagement.

According to the company, the decision to offer premium beverages by the glass aligns with efforts to create more flexible hospitality experiences while maintaining premium service standards.

Management added that the concept was developed around the belief that hospitality experiences are increasingly defined by genuine connections, shared moments and well-curated environments rather than traditional nightlife spectacle alone.

For Lagos’ hospitality industry, the emergence of concepts such as The Chambrès Lagos signals a growing market for venues that blend entertainment, networking and lifestyle experiences, particularly among young professionals and affluent consumers seeking alternatives to conventional nightlife destinations.
